WebDynamoDB Streams capture a time-ordered sequence of events in any DynamoDB table. It is also referred to as Change Data Capture. Whenever an application crea... WebChange data capture for DynamoDB Streams. DynamoDB Streams captures a time-ordered sequence of item-level modifications in any DynamoDB table and stores this information in a log for up to 24 hours. Applications can access this log and view the data items as they appeared before and after they were modified, in near-real time. michigan upper peninsula resorts

WebAug 31, 2024 · When enabling Streams, DynamoDB creates at least one Shard per partition in the DynamoDB table. When a Lambda function is used to process the events in the DynamoDB Stream, one instance of the Lambda Function is invoked per Shard in the Stream. A Lambda function such as this needs permissions to read data from a … michigan upper peninsula township mapWebWith DynamoDB Streams, you can configure an AWS Lambda function to be run every time there is an update to your DynamoDB table. With this functionality you can send out transactional emails, update the records in other tables and databases, run periodic cleanups and table rollovers, implement activity counters, and much more.
